В последние годы сфера интернета вещей (IoT) и беспроводных сенсорных сетей (WSN) активно развивается. Среди различных типов сенсоров датчики давления играют важную роль. Они используются для измерения атмосферного давления, высоты, температуры и даже погодных изменений. Сегодня мы рассмотрим два основных датчика давления — BMP180 и BMP280, которые разрабатывались компанией Bosch Sensortec GmbH.
Оба датчика измеряют давление и температуру и могут быть использованы в реализации проектов IoT. Однако стоит отметить, что BMP280 является усовершенствованной версией BMP180, поэтому заметны различия в технических характеристиках. BMP280 имеет более высокую точность и надежность при работе под разными условиями. Однако, стоит ли переплачивать за дополнительную точность или BMP180 будет достаточен для реализации проекта?
Чтобы разобраться в отличиях между этими двумя датчиками, в статье мы рассмотрим особенности BMP180 и BMP280, сравним их технические характеристики и узнаем, какой датчик лучше выбрать для конкретной задачи.
Сравнение датчиков BMP180 и BMP280: особенности и отличия
В мире существует множество различных датчиков для измерения параметров окружающей среды, в том числе и для измерения атмосферного давления и температуры. Два наиболее популярных датчика для этих задач — BMP180 и BMP280. Рассмотрим их особенности и отличия.
Основные отличия между BMP180 и BMP280:
- Диапазон измерения: BMP180 измеряет давление от 300 до 1100 гПа, а BMP280 — от 300 до 1200 гПа.
- Точность: BMP280 более точен, чем BMP180. Погрешность измерения атмосферного давления для BMP280 составляет ±1 гПа, а для BMP180 — ±2 гПа. Точность измерения температуры у обоих датчиков одинаковая — ±1 градус Цельсия.
- Скорость измерения: BMP280 может измерять давление и температуру значительно быстрее, чем BMP180.
- Расход энергии: BMP280 потребляет меньше энергии, чем BMP180.
Когда выбрать BMP180, а когда BMP280?
Если ваше приложение не требует высокой точности измерения атмосферного давления и вы не настаиваете на быстром обновлении данных, можете выбрать BMP180 — он более доступный и потребляет меньше энергии. BMP280 лучше подойдет для более требовательных задач, где важны быстрое обновление данных и высокая точность измерений.
Таким образом, BMP280 — это более продвинутый датчик, который обеспечивает более точные и быстрые измерения, но при этом потребляет больше энергии. BMP180 — это более доступный и экономичный вариант, который подойдет для задач, не требующих высокой точности измерений.
BMP180: особенности
BMP180 — это аналоговый датчик давления и температуры, который был выпущен компанией Bosch. Он сочетает в себе высокую точность измерений и низкое энергопотребление, что делает его идеальным для использования в различных проектах.
Датчик BMP180 работает при диапазоне напряжения от 1,8 до 3,6 В, что позволяет использовать его с различными микроконтроллерами. Он способен измерять атмосферное давление в диапазоне от 300 до 1100 гектопаскалей, а температуру в диапазоне от -40 до +85 градусов Цельсия.
Одним из главных преимуществ BMP180 является его низкое энергопотребление. Даже при максимальной частоте измерений, датчик потребляет всего 0,5 мА. Это делает BMP180 подходящим для использования в проектах, требующих длительной работы от автономных источников питания.
Дополнительно стоит отметить, что BMP180 обладает высокой точностью измерений. Для измерения температуры точность данных достигает ±2 градусов Цельсия, а при измерении давления точность достигает ±1 гектопаскаля.
Следует также учесть, что BMP180 является более старой версией датчика, на смену которой пришел BMP280, который имеет ряд значительных улучшений.
BMP280: особенности
Датчик BMP280 является усовершенствованной версией BMP180 и имеет более высокую точность измерения атмосферного давления и температуры.
Основные особенности BMP280:
- Точность измерения давления: BMP280 может измерять давление до 1100 гектопаскалей с точностью 0,12 гектопаскаля.
- Точность измерения температуры: BMP280 может измерять температуру с точностью 0,01 градуса Цельсия.
- Низкий уровень шума: BMP280 обеспечивает более низкий уровень шума, что делает его еще более точным.
- Интерфейс: BMP280 поддерживает цифровой интерфейс I2C и SPI, что делает его более гибким в использовании.
- Низкое потребление энергии: BMP280 потребляет всего 2,7 микроампера в режиме ожидания и 0,1 микроампера в режиме сна, что позволяет увеличить время автономной работы устройства.
Благодаря этим особенностям, BMP280 является предпочтительным выбором для измерения атмосферного давления и температуры в различных приложениях, включая автоматизированные системы контроля погоды, промышленные системы автоматизации и устройства IoТ.
Отличия между датчиками BMP180 и BMP280
1. Точность показаний:
Одним из основных отличий между датчиками BMP180 и BMP280 является точность показаний. BMP280 обладает более высокой точностью измерения давления и температуры, чем BMP180, что делает его более подходящим для задач, требующих высокой точности измерений.
2. Интерфейс:
Датчики имеют различные интерфейсы для связи с микроконтроллером. BMP180 поддерживает только интерфейс I2C, а BMP280 — интерфейсы I2C и SPI. Это может быть важным фактором выбора, если необходимо использовать определенный интерфейс для соединения.
3. Напряжение питания:
Датчики имеют различные напряжения питания. BMP180 работает в диапазоне 1,8-3,6 В, а BMP280 — в диапазоне 1,7-3,6 В. Это может быть важным фактором выбора, если требуется работа с определенным напряжением.
4. Размер:
BMP280 немного больше, чем BMP180. Размер BMP280 составляет 2,5 x 2,5 мм, в то время как размер BMP180 составляет 1,8 x 1,6 мм. Это может быть важным фактором выбора, если нужно сэкономить место на плате.
5. Стоимость:
Стоимость BMP280 обычно выше, чем BMP180, но это может зависеть от конкретного продавца и региона. Если стоимость является важным фактором при выборе датчика, то следует обратить внимание на разницу в ценах.
Применение в различных устройствах
BMP180:
- Погодные станции;
- Устройства для измерения высоты;
- Датчики температуры и давления в автомобилях.
Датчик BMP180 обладает достаточно высоким разрешением измерения давления и температуры, что позволяет использовать его в проектах, где необходим высокий уровень точности.
BMP280:
- Системы навигации;
- Устройства IoT (интернета вещей);
- Датчики для анализа качества воздуха.
Датчик BMP280 является более совершенной и усовершенствованной версией BMP180, он обладает высоким разрешением и точностью измерения, а также имеет низкий уровень энергопотребления, что позволяет использовать его в устройствах, работающих на батарейках.
Таким образом, выбор датчика зависит от требований к точности и энергопотреблению, а также от конкретной задачи, для которой он предназначен.
Как выбрать между BMP180 и BMP280
Когда нужно выбрать датчик давления для своего проекта или устройства, возникает вопрос о том, какой из датчиков выбрать — BMP180 или BMP280. Оба датчика имеют много общих особенностей и сходств, но есть и небольшие отличия между ними, которые могут оказаться решающими в конкретном случае.
Во-первых, стоит учитывать точность измерений. BMP280 имеет более высокую точность измерений давления и температуры, чем BMP180. Это особенно важно для проектов, где требуется высокая точность измерений.
Во-вторых, следует учитывать потребляемую мощность. BMP280 потребляет больше энергии, чем BMP180. Если важна экономия энергии, то стоит выбрать BMP180.
Одним из важных факторов выбора может стать также цена датчика. BMP280 дороже, чем BMP180. Если на выборе стоит вопрос о бюджете, то BMP180 может оказаться более предпочтительным вариантом.
В итоге, при выборе между BMP180 и BMP280 следует учитывать точность измерений, потребляемую мощность и цену датчика. В каждом конкретном случае можно выбрать наиболее подходящий вариант, исходя из своих потребностей и возможностей.